Revolve Labs, a leader in Bitcoin mining, has announced intentions to build a new data center in Glencoe, Minnesota, aiming to enhance its transaction processing capabilities.
Revolve Labs Project
The new facility will feature one or two AI-powered data centers, advanced cooling systems, and backup generators. This large-scale undertaking is part of the company's strategy to bolster its capacity to manage the resource-heavy process of Bitcoin mining.
Expansion Plans
In a September meeting with the Glencoe Economic Development Authority, Revolve Labs outlined its vision, estimating the project's cost between $40 million and $60 million. The facility will include a new power substation and is expected to create around 10 jobs, contributing to the local economy.
Impact on Local Community and Environment
Local residents have expressed concerns about potential noise pollution from cooling systems and machinery. Revolve Labs has expressed readiness to address these issues, emphasizing the importance of maintaining local quality of life.
